>One of the most important facts of the road is... not that we have
>almost equal access by law. It is the fact that we have to deal with the
>perception of cyclists by uninformed motorists, even if it is flawed.
>Defensive cycling is a must. I am personally a bit aggressive on the
>road, establishing my presence in a way that does not break the law, but
>probably pisses a few drivers off, because I may make them slow down and
>go around me. I spent 10 years commuting in heavy traffic for 1.5 hours
>a day in an area that had never heard of bike racing. In those cases you
>learn how to defend yourself. Admittedly, there is no fail safe method,
>as I was struck by a hit and run driver 6 years ago and feel fortunate
>to have lived through the ordeal. In that case, I was riding with 2
>others in a single pace line in the rain as the sun was setting and
>visibility was questionable. So I was trying to stay close to the
>shoulder. Possibly a mistake, but who can say. Anyway...I ramble. To
>illustrate my point, 3 of my friends were cycling this weekend and were
>nearly wiped out by an elderly woman who decided to pass them in a
>residential area. As she accelerated by them, she blew a stop sign on
>Bethany Blvd and was broadsided by a pickup. When she emerged from her
>vehicle she tried to blame the cyclists for causing the accident. Her
>perception caused her to break the law because she was not focused on
>driving safely, but rather on getting by these annoying cyclists. That's
>the reality I am talking about.Mike Manning> From: montyh@tvapdx.com>
